The workforce medical company data breach settlement offers
Americans the chance to claim between $500 and $3,500.
Acuity must have notified applicants of a data security incident on or around February 15, 2022, to qualify.
Previously known as Comprehensive Health Services, Acuity is a workforce
Medical company that was involved in a data breach in 2022.
In the class action lawsuit, Acuity is accused of failing to protect the personal
information of over 100,000 people from unauthorized access.
Comprehensive Health Services did not admit fault, but agreed to settle the lawsuit for an undisclosed sum.

If you are one of the consumers whose information has been stolen,
you can receive up to $500 for any expenses you incurred.
It can include bank fees, credit card expenses, and three hours of lost time at $20 per hour.
A payment of up to $3,500 is available if your identity was stolen
Due to the breach, as long as you can show documented expenses.
Acuity's data breach settlement allows you to receive two years of free credit monitoring,
Even if you didn't experience identity theft or out-of-pocket costs.
